GetSpoolFileメソッド
指定したジョブIDのスプールデータに格納されている印刷データを,指定したパスにファイルで取得します。
OutputFileKindプロパティで取得ファイル形式にEPF形式を指定している場合,またはOutputFileKindプロパティの指定を省略している場合は,印刷データをEPF形式ファイルで取得します。
OutputFileKindプロパティで取得ファイル形式にPDF形式を指定している場合は,印刷データをPDF形式ファイルで取得します。
取得後のファイルは,OutputFileNameプロパティで指定したファイル名になります。
指定したパスに同一名のファイルがある場合は,上書きされます。スプールデータの取得については,マニュアル「EUR 帳票出力 機能解説 EUR Server編」を参照してください。
形式
GetSpoolFile ()
パラメタ
なし
解説
GetSpoolFileメソッドは,スプールサーバ上のスプールデータ内の印刷データをOutputFilePathプロパティで指定されたフォルダにファイル出力が終了した時点で呼び出し元に制御が戻ります。
取得ファイル形式はOutputFileKindプロパティで指定します。
実行時にエラーが発生した場合,Err.Numberプロパティに終了コード,Err.Descriptionプロパティにメッセージが設定されます。
戻り値
なし
データ型
Empty
呼び出し例
' GetSpoolFile実行
Private Sub SUB_GetSpoolFile()
Err.Clear
On Error GoTo Err_Trap
List5.Clear
Dim objEURPMLS
Set objEURPMLS = CreateObject("EURPMLS.Exec")
objEURPMLS.ServerAddress = "255.255.***.***"
objEURPMLS.SearchJobID = "E00200605291252462630000001******007"
''取得フォルダの設定
objEURPMLS.OutputFilePath = "c:\\tmp"
''取得実行
Call objEURPMLS.GetSpoolFile
Err_Trap:
List5.AddItem "GetAttr Err.Number=(" & Err.Number & ")"
List5.AddItem "GetAttr Err.Description=(" & Err.Description & ")"
Set objEURPMLS = Nothing
End Sub